the first archetype is the bangkok branch of a european professional services firm. law, audit, consulting, accounting, architecture, engineering. 40 to 200 staff in bangkok, parent company in london, frankfurt, paris, amsterdam or brussels. the buyer here is the bangkok md or the regional digital officer based out of singapore. budget signed in usd or eur. they need pdpa-compliant tools for thai clients, gdpr-compliant tools for eu clients, and a vendor that can write a master services agreement their legal team in europe will sign without 12 rounds of redlining.

the second archetype is the bangkok subsidiary of a us or european fintech, saas or consumer technology company. 60 to 400 staff in bangkok. office in t-one, fyi center or one bangkok. parent company in san francisco, berlin, london or stockholm. the buyer is the local cto or the head of bangkok engineering. they need senior engineering capacity in the bangkok timezone without flying a sf or berlin engineer business class for two weeks. they need someone who can speak to the parent company's security review (soc 2 awareness, iso 27001 alignment, gdpr article 30 register) and to the thai pdpa officer at the same time.

the third archetype is the bangkok regional headquarters serving sea. trading company, manufacturing back office, brand licensing, e-commerce logistics, regional marketing hub. 30 to 150 staff. parent company in europe, japan, australia or the us. the buyer is the regional digital lead or the bangkok-based coo. they need a digital partner who can ship across thailand, vietnam, indonesia, malaysia and the philippines without forcing the parent company to onboard 5 different vendors. dual-compliance posture is the qualifier.

how do you handle pdpa plus gdpr dual compliance for a bangkok branch?

every build ships with both regimes covered. pdpa b.e. 2562 (sections 19, 23 to 29, 37, cross-border per section 28) register tracks thai data subjects. gdpr article 30 register tracks eu data subjects. cookie consent satisfies both standards in one mechanism with separate granular controls. data residency mapping documents where customer data physically lives, with aws region of your choice and an eu region available for eu-resident data. dpa templates signed with every subprocessor. all of this is a deliverable line item with a fixed price, not a billable-by-the-hour ambiguity.

is there a belgium-thailand tax treaty consideration on the invoices?

yes. the belgium-thailand double tax treaty has been in force since 1980 and prevents double taxation on professional services rendered between the two jurisdictions. for a thai-resident buyer paying piexels (a belgian or us-domiciled supplier), the treaty article on independent professional services typically eliminates thai withholding tax. for an eu-headquartered parent company paying piexels (eu supplier) into a bangkok branch operating account, the standard intra-eu treatment applies. your thai accountant or tax partner will confirm the exact filing path for your structure.
